by Lee Kohn (Author)
This is a story about a humble man sent to prison in Arizona for a crime he didn't commit. He finds that he has a brain tumor and doesn't have long to live. He is set free on probation after serving years and buys a old Harley Road king and sets out on a journey to prove his innocence. This sets up a chain of events that will take him to a small town run by corrupt people surrounded by old friends.. He ends up attempting to cross a desert known as no man land to escape the clutches of corrupt police and an enemy from his past...
